Exclusive: Crawford Hoying scraps plan for condo tower attached to Bridge Park hotel in favor of office building

 

"'Even though we've had unbelievable success with condos, we are changing that tower to office,' Crawford said. "We think because of the prominent corner that it holds, the interest we've had and people wanting to be in this market, we think it makes a perfect office location."

 

Crawford added that there will be "a number of first-class amenities" surrounding the office building and hotel, including a possible spa.

 

That's in addition to other amenities planned for the project, including the Cameron Mitchell restaurant, more food and beverage options, multiple outdoor spaces and an event and conference center.

 

Dublin City Council authorized a development agreement for the project this month, which Crawford called "a big step." The project still needs planning and zoning approval, but assuming that is approved by the city, construction will begin in late 2024, Crawford said."

Crawford Hoying plots new townhomes at Bridge Park

 

Crawford Hoying wants to bring more residential units to its Bridge Park development in Dublin.

 

The developer recently submitted amended plans for 42 townhomes on two parcels at the intersection of John Shields Parkway and Mooney Street, which is located in Bridge Park's H Block.

 

The units would be built on a 2.24-acre property next to an existing townhome complex.

Crawford Hoying to expand Bridge Park with new mixed-use project

 

Bridge Park developer Crawford Hoying is planning a new phase of the mixed-use development in Dublin.

 

A concept plan submitted to the city shows an office building, condominiums and a parking garage on a 5.4-acre site at 4455 Bridge Park Ave. Located next to the Wendy's headquarters and Joseph Cadillac Dublin, the project will expand Bridge Park to the east. It will be known as J Block.

More Details Revealed as Bridge Park Expansion Clears First Hurdle

 

A plan to expand Bridge Park to the south – across SR 161 for the first time – took an important step forward last week. The proposal calls for a new condo tower, office building, parking garage and hotel, all situated at the southeast corner of the 161/Riverside Drive intersection.

...

Representatives of the developer, Crawford Hoying, updated the board on changes made since the proposal was first submitted in 2023. The latest plan calls for a three-story parking garage topped with an eight-story residential tower on the northeast corner and a seven story hotel positioned closest to Riverside Drive. A four-story office building would be located on the southeast corner of the parcel.
